About Hacker Newsletter
Hacker Newsletter takes the firehose of Hacker News and distills it into an easy-to-read weekly email. It covers the top links in tech, science, and design, often including high-quality discussions and obscure technical articles.
What Makes This Newsletter Unique
Saves hours of scrolling on Hacker News. It picks the truly 'evergreen' and high-quality links that represent the curiosity of the hacker community.
Who Should Subscribe?
Engineers and founders who love the content on HN but don't want to check the front page every hour.
Content Format
A categorization of top links with short descriptions and links to the HN discussion thread.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is it affiliated with Y Combinator?
No, it is an independent publication that curates content from the Hacker News site (which is owned by YC).
How often is Hacker Newsletter published?
Hacker Newsletter is published weekly.
Who writes Hacker Newsletter?
Hacker Newsletter is written by Kale Davis. Kale Davis is the creator and editor of Hacker Newsletter. He started the publication to help tech professionals catch up on the best of HN without the noise.
